22 lines
1.8 KiB
TypeScript
22 lines
1.8 KiB
TypeScript
export * from '@tanstack/query-core';
|
|
export { DefinedUseInfiniteQueryResult, DefinedUseQueryResult, UseBaseMutationResult, UseBaseQueryOptions, UseBaseQueryResult, UseInfiniteQueryOptions, UseInfiniteQueryResult, UseMutateAsyncFunction, UseMutateFunction, UseMutationOptions, UseMutationResult, UseQueryOptions, UseQueryResult, UseSuspenseInfiniteQueryOptions, UseSuspenseInfiniteQueryResult, UseSuspenseQueryOptions, UseSuspenseQueryResult } from './types.js';
|
|
export { QueriesOptions, QueriesResults, useQueries } from './useQueries.js';
|
|
export { useQuery } from './useQuery.js';
|
|
export { useSuspenseQuery } from './useSuspenseQuery.js';
|
|
export { useSuspenseInfiniteQuery } from './useSuspenseInfiniteQuery.js';
|
|
export { SuspenseQueriesOptions, SuspenseQueriesResults, useSuspenseQueries } from './useSuspenseQueries.js';
|
|
export { usePrefetchQuery } from './usePrefetchQuery.js';
|
|
export { usePrefetchInfiniteQuery } from './usePrefetchInfiniteQuery.js';
|
|
export { DefinedInitialDataOptions, UndefinedInitialDataOptions, queryOptions } from './queryOptions.js';
|
|
export { DefinedInitialDataInfiniteOptions, UndefinedInitialDataInfiniteOptions, infiniteQueryOptions } from './infiniteQueryOptions.js';
|
|
export { QueryClientContext, QueryClientProvider, QueryClientProviderProps, useQueryClient } from './QueryClientProvider.js';
|
|
export { QueryErrorResetBoundary, QueryErrorResetBoundaryProps, useQueryErrorResetBoundary } from './QueryErrorResetBoundary.js';
|
|
export { HydrationBoundary, HydrationBoundaryProps } from './HydrationBoundary.js';
|
|
export { useIsFetching } from './useIsFetching.js';
|
|
export { useIsMutating, useMutationState } from './useMutationState.js';
|
|
export { useMutation } from './useMutation.js';
|
|
export { useInfiniteQuery } from './useInfiniteQuery.js';
|
|
export { IsRestoringProvider, useIsRestoring } from './isRestoring.js';
|
|
import 'react';
|
|
import 'react/jsx-runtime';
|